Why Does Ofilmyzilla Keep Changing Domains?

You might search for "Ofilmyzilla-com" today and find it working, but tomorrow it may show a "404 Not Found." This is because ISPs (Internet Service Providers) in India are legally required to block these domains.

The operators of Ofilmyzilla play a game of "Whack-a-Mole." As soon as one domain (e.g., ofilmyzilla.com) is blocked, they launch a new one (e.g., ofilmyzilla.in, ofilmyzilla.buzz, ofilmyzilla.trade).
